Comprehending the Art Behind Metal Stamping


At its core, metal stamping is the process of transforming flat metal sheets right into particular forms with force and accuracy. This isn't a one-size-fits-all procedure; it entails several strategies like flexing, punching, coining, and embossing-- each picked for the job available. Every bend and cut is performed with incredible accuracy, assisted by the devices and dies crafted for the job.


This procedure demands greater than just makers-- it requires an experienced group and advanced modern technology. The creativity of tool and die shops hinge on developing personalized passes away that enable the specific recreation of components, down to the smallest information. Whether creating easy braces or complicated auto parts, precision is non-negotiable.


Just How Metal Stamping Powers Modern Living


Look around your home or office and you'll find countless items gave birth to by metal stamping. The structural frame of your dishwasher, the adapters in your smart device, the bracket holding your automobile's dashboard-- all these components owe their presence to stamped metal.


In the automotive globe, the demand for sturdiness and consistency makes progressive die marking a preferred. This technique entails a series of terminals, each doing a distinct feature as the metal breakthroughs with the press. It's excellent for high-volume runs and makes sure each piece satisfies exacting standards.


Yet it doesn't quit with vehicles. In the clinical field, where integrity can be a case of need, metal stamping is made use of to craft surgical tools and tool components. In the aerospace sector, marked parts have to stand up to severe problems while meeting tight resistances. The same is true in customer electronic devices, where space-saving, high-functionality designs require stamped steel elements that are both light-weight and solid.


Accuracy, Speed, and Reliability: Why Metal Stamping Matters


So why has metal stamping become such a go-to technique throughout numerous industries? Primarily: rate. Once the passes away are established, thousands of identical parts can be created with little variant. This level of repeatability is vital when consistency issues.


Then there's the inquiry of cost-effectiveness. Typical machining might take longer and entail more material waste. But marking, specifically when finished with progressive die innovation, maintains manufacturing scooting and effectively. It's one of the most intelligent methods to fulfill high-volume production objectives without compromising high quality.


The dependability of this procedure likewise can't be overstated. When you're producing thousands-- or even millions-- of components, a tiny imperfection can come to be a large issue.
